Zusammenfassung:PURPOSE:To prevent the formation of linear fine grains and to stably obtain the steel sheet by using a continuously cast slab having a specific columnar crystal region as a starting material in a method for producing a steel slab with a specific composition by high temp. heating. CONSTITUTION:A slab of a silicon steel having a composition consisting of, by weight, 0.01-0.2% C, 0.010-0.060% acid-soluble Al, 0.0030-0.0130% N, 0.01-0.06% S, 0.080-0.45% Mn, and the balance Fe, is heated up to >=1250 deg.C, hot-rolled, cold-rolled, and subjected to annealing for decarburization and primary recrystallization. After a separation agent at annealing is applied, finish annealing is done. In this method, a continuously cast slab having, at least from one slab surface, a >=35% columnal crystal region in a thickness direction is used as a starting material. By this method, secondary recrystallization can be done in a superior state and the rate of the generation of linear fine grains can be reduced, and the steel sheet can be produced more stably than heretofore.
